The dark side of clickbait: how fake video links deliver malware

Intel Name: The dark side of clickbait: how fake video links deliver malware

Date of Scan: February 26, 2025

Impact: High

Summary:
“The Dark Side of Clickbait: How Fake Video Links Deliver Malware” highlights a surge in phishing campaigns that use fake viral video links to trick users into downloading malware. The attack relies on social engineering, redirecting victims through multiple malicious websites before delivering the payload. Users are enticed with promises of exclusive content, leading them to fraudulent pages and deceptive download links.
